Liverpool are set to land Barcelona winger Cristian Tello on loan for the rest of the season, according to reports in Spain.
Brendan Rodgers' bid to take Liverpool back to the Champions League has suffered in the last week following back-to-back defeats at Manchester City and Chelsea and the accumulation of several injuries to first-team players.
Following the 2-1 defeat at Stamford Bridge, Rodgers expressed his desire to bring in reinforcements in January and Radio Marca claim Tello will be the first new arrival at Anfield next month.
The 22-year-old, rated at £10.5m, has managed just two league starts for Barca this season and admitted last month that he would consider leaving the Nou Camp if his first-team prospects did not improve.
Tello, who is under contract until 2018, has one senior cap for Spain and featured prominently during the Under-21's European Championship-winning campaign in Israel back in June.
